Man 'punched in face' in Milton Road, Gravesend

A short bald man is being hunted by police after a man was punched in the face.

The victim, who is in his 30s, was attacked as he walked along Milton Road in Gravesend, close to the junction with Peacock Street.

He went to hospital, where he was treated for an injury to his face.

The suspect is described as being short and bald, with short hair on the sides. He was wearing dark trousers and a black coat with white print.

It all happened at around 3.25am on Sunday, August 1, but detectives believe there are people who may have witnessed the assault who have yet to come forward.

Anyone with information, or dash cam footage recorded in the area at the time, is asked to call police on 01474 366149 quoting 46/137965/21.
